Key Factors Buyers Should Evaluate Before Purchasing A Home

Key Factors Buyers Should Evaluate Before Purchasing A Home

Posted on July 6, 2026July 6, 2026 By Michael Caine No Comments on Key Factors Buyers Should Evaluate Before Purchasing A Home
Homes

Buying a home is one of the most significant financial decisions anyone can make. Whether you are purchasing your first property or upgrading to a larger house, careful planning can help you avoid costly mistakes. A well informed buyer considers everything from budget and location to legal documentation and future growth potential. Taking the time to evaluate these factors ensures that your investment remains valuable for years to come.

Set a Realistic Budget

The first step in purchasing a home is determining how much you can comfortably afford. Besides the purchase price, buyers should account for registration fees, maintenance costs, property taxes, insurance, and potential renovation expenses. Creating a complete financial plan allows you to make confident decisions without stretching your finances too far.

If you plan to finance your purchase through a home loan, compare interest rates, repayment terms, and processing charges from multiple lenders before making a commitment.

Choose the Right Location

Location plays a major role in both your daily lifestyle and the long term value of your property. Consider the distance to schools, hospitals, workplaces, shopping centers, and public transportation. A neighborhood with strong infrastructure and planned developments often experiences better appreciation over time.

Safety, traffic conditions, and future urban development should also be evaluated before making your final decision.

Verify Legal Documents

Never purchase a property without verifying all legal documentation. Ensure that ownership records, title deeds, approvals, and land records are accurate and up to date. Conducting proper legal verification helps prevent future disputes and protects your investment.

Evaluate the Property Condition

Even a visually attractive home may have hidden structural problems. Inspect the property carefully for cracks, water leakage, plumbing issues, electrical wiring, roofing quality, and ventilation. If necessary, hire a professional inspector to assess the overall condition of the house.

A detailed inspection may save thousands in future repair costs.

Consider Future Development

Think beyond your current needs. A growing neighborhood with planned infrastructure, commercial developments, schools, and transportation projects may significantly increase your property’s value over the coming years.

Research local development plans and government announcements to understand how the surrounding area may evolve.

Check Builder Reputation

If you are buying a newly constructed property, research the builder’s background thoroughly. Review previous projects, customer feedback, construction quality, and project delivery timelines. A reputable developer is more likely to deliver quality construction and fulfill contractual commitments.

Meeting existing residents of completed projects can also provide valuable insights into the builder’s reliability.

Review Resale Potential

Even if you plan to live in the property for many years, resale value should remain an important consideration. Homes located in desirable neighborhoods with quality infrastructure, educational institutions, and commercial facilities generally attract more buyers in the future.

Features such as parking, security, energy efficiency, and modern layouts also contribute to higher resale demand.

Assess Community and Lifestyle

Your home should complement your lifestyle. Visit the neighborhood during different times of the day to observe traffic, noise levels, cleanliness, and community activities. Speak with nearby residents whenever possible to gain a better understanding of the area’s living conditions.

Families with children may prioritize schools and parks, while professionals may focus on commuting convenience and nearby business districts.

Plan for Long Term Financial Stability

Home ownership involves ongoing financial responsibilities beyond the initial purchase. Monthly mortgage payments, maintenance, emergency repairs, and utility expenses should all fit comfortably within your long term financial plan.
